Europe Digital Oilfield Market Size

Europe Digital Oilfield Market was valued at USD 7.1 billion in 2023 and is predicted to witness more than 6.5% CAGR from 2024 to 2032.The region's continuous emphasis on optimizing operational efficiency and reducing production costs has led to the widespread adoption of digital technologies in the oil and gas sector. The need to extract oil and gas from aging and mature fields has fueled the demand for digital oilfield services across Europe.
 

Europe Digital Oilfield Market

Stringent environmental regulations have encouraged the implementation of digital solutions that monitor and reduce the industry's environmental footprint. Furthermore, the growing availability of high-speed connectivity and the integration of cloud computing and big data analytics are further propelling the market by enabling real-time data analysis and decision-making. These collective factors are reshaping the European oil and gas industry, driving the adoption of digital technologies for enhanced operational efficiency and sustainable practices.

Europe Digital Oilfield Market Trends

The Europe digital oilfield industry is witnessing several prominent trends. There is a growing focus on data analytics and artificial intelligence, which are being used to optimize production, predict equipment failures, and enhance reservoir management. The adoption of IoT sensors and automation is on the rise, allowing for real-time monitoring of field operations and improved decision-making. Additionally, there's a shift toward remote operations and digital twins, enabling companies to manage assets and processes virtually, reducing the need for on-site personnel. Partnerships and collaborations between technology providers and oil and gas companies are fostering innovation and the development of tailored digital solutions.

Russia Digital Oilfield Market Size, 2021 - 2032, (USD Billion)

Russia digital oilfield market valuation to cross USD 3.7 billion in 2022 and is poised to reach USD 6.7 billion by 2032, owing to the need to modernize aging oil infrastructure, which in turn has pushed the industry to adopt advanced technologies such as IoT and automation, enhancing operational efficiency and reducing maintenance costs. Additionally, the country's emphasis on digitalization aligns with government initiatives to improve energy sector efficiency and reduce environmental impact, further boosting the adoption of digital technologies. These drivers, combined with a growing focus on data analytics, are propelling the expansion of Russia's digital oilfield market, promising increased productivity, cost savings, and sustainability in the sector.

Europe Digital Oilfield Industry News:

  • In October 2022, GE Digital, a subsidiary of General Electric, unveiled CIMPLICITY and iFIX software designed for SCADA/HMI applications within the oil and gas sector. These cutting-edge software solutions offer accelerated development and heightened efficiency through native HMI, HTML5, MQTT, a unified portfolio configuration, and centralized deployment. Furthermore, this software release streamlines maintenance and installation efforts by incorporating HTML5 HMI with the Procify Operations Hub, leading to notable reductions in associated workload and installation complexities.
     
  • In April 2021, ABB announced that it has received a supply contract from Equinor, which is an energy solution provider, to deliver automation solutions for the Krafla field across North Sea. Under the contract, the company will provide an Unmanned Process Platform (UPP) which will be remotely operated from an onshore control centre. Moreover, ABB will further offer monitoring and control services for various units including subsea production system and the unmanned wellhead platform. The contract will enhance the company’s presence across the North Sea along with the digital oilfield industry, thereby boosting its market share in the coming years.
